Overview

This IP is an inductorless DC/DC converter (charge pump) that provides a stable and configurable output voltage VOC (from 4.8V to 5.5V) for loads up to 20mA.

It is designed to work from 3MHz clock circuit and features limitation of in-rush current and power saving mode.

This IP uses external flying capacitors to supply maximum load.

Key features

  • Inductorless boost voltage regulator (charge pump)
  • Maximumoutput ripple: ±20mV
  • Efficiency: (75 %) 
  • Output load up to 20mA
  • Input voltage: 2.5– 5.5V
  • Output voltage: 4.85– 5.5V
  • Output voltage accuracy: 5%
  • 3MHz switching frequency
  • Core area: 0.351mm2
